Job Summary
Responsible for conducting analysis, pricing, and risk assessment to estimate financial outcomes, the full-time Actuary - Employee Benefits will work remotely, applying mathematical and statistical knowledge to support health and welfare insurance solutions.
Key responsibilities
- Provides business leadership and analytical expertise for significant strategic initiatives
- Conducts qualitative and quantitative analysis of data to identify trends and inform decision-making
- Develops reports and presentations to assist management in implementing optimal business solutions
Required qualifications
- Bachelor's Degree in Actuarial Science, Mathematics, Statistics, or a related quantitative field
- Ten or more years of related work experience
- Associateship in the Casualty Actuarial Society (ACAS) or Society of Actuaries (ASA) required, with a commitment to achieving Fellowship preferred
